Bold colors and impossible-to-miss CTAs… that’s the shared DNA here. Here are some tips to make your site convert:
- Lead with transformation, not logistics. Laffapalooza!
promises “pure comedy entertainment fun” instead of listing showtimes. Your headline should sell the feeling. - Use bold color contrasts to guide the eye to registration. Wix conference sites like Congo Tech Connect
pair striking orange on black to make event details pop. Wix venue websites like Jazz Venue
use warm palettes that match their vibe. And Wix florist sites like Rose & Rhubarb
prove moody palettes work too. - Make your CTA unavoidable. The Best Family Reunion
centers its RSVP button with bold purple and pink accents… you literally can’t scroll past it.
